@charset "iso-8859-2";
body {
	margin:0px; 
	padding:0px; 
	background: url(imagens/fundo.jpg) top center repeat-x;
	background-color:#c6c6c6;
}
#principal{
   width: 1000px;
   margin:auto;
   background-color:#1e1a19;
}
#topo{
   width: 100%;
   height:160px;
   margin:auto;
  
}
#logo{
   padding-left:45px;
   padding-top:15px;
   float:left;
}
#solucoes{
   padding-right:70px;
   padding-top:65px;
   float: right;
   font-family: Trebuchet MS, Arial;
   color:#828180;
   font-size:28px;
   
}
#corpo_home{
   width: 634px;
   margin:auto;
   text-align:center;
}
#corpo{
   width: 550px;
   margin:auto;
   text-align:center;
}
#corpo2{
   width: 635px;
   margin:auto;
}
#corpo_programas{
   clear:both;
   width: 972px;
   margin:auto;
}
#areas{
   width: 750px;
   margin:auto;
   padding-top:0px;
}
#areas_interna{
   width: 698px;
   margin:auto;
   padding:0px;
}
#menu_inferior{
   width: 900px;
   margin:auto;
   padding-top:15px;
   text-align:center;
}
#portifolio{
   width: 169px;
   margin:auto;
   font-family: Trebuchet MS, Arial;
   color:#FFFFFF;
   text-align:center;
   font-size:33px;
}

#titulo_extras{
   width: 400px;
   margin:auto;
   font-family: Trebuchet MS, Arial;
   color:#f58b00;
   text-align:center;
   font-size:33px;
}

#titulo_extras2{
   width: 400px;
   margin:auto;
   font-family: Trebuchet MS, Arial;
   color:#f58b00;
   text-align:center;
   font-size:25px;
}
/************************************************** Internas Inicio **********************************************************/
#logo_interna{
   padding-left:45px;
   padding-top:15px;
   float:left;
   width: 287px;
}
#titulo_interna{
   padding-top:65px;
   width:350px;
   font-family: Trebuchet MS, Arial;
   color:#ffffff;
   font-size:28px;
   text-align:center;
   float:left;
   
}
#imagem_topo_interna{
   float: right;
   padding-right:45px;
   padding-top:45px;
   top:-160px;
   position:relative;
   margin-bottom:-160px;
}

#corpo_internas{

   margin:auto;
   font-family: Trebuchet MS, Arial;
   color:#000000;
   padding:0px 15px 0px 15px;
   background-color:#FFFFFF;
}

#corpo_internas ul, ol {
	margin:0;
	padding:0;
	list-style:none;
	}

#corpo_parceiros{
   margin:auto;
   font-family: Trebuchet MS, Arial;
   color:#000000;
   padding:0px 15px 0px 15px;
   background-color:#FFFFFF;
   min-height:450px;
}

#corpo_parceiros ul, ol {
	margin:0;
	padding:0;
	list-style:none;
	}

#areas_internas{
   width: 908px;
   margin:auto;
}
#imagem_topo_interna_area{
   padding-right:45px;
   padding-top:15px;
   float: right;
}
.esquerda {
	float:left;
	margin-right:20px;
/*	margin-bottom:200px; */
}
.direita {
	float:right;
	margin-left:20px;
}
.direita-interna {
	margin-left:320px;
}
.titulo {
   font-family: Trebuchet MS, Arial;
   color:#f58b00;
   font-weight:bold;
   font-size:14px;
}
.laranja {
   font-family: Trebuchet MS, Arial;
   color:#f58b00;
   font-size:16px;
}
.branco {
   font-family: Trebuchet MS, Arial;
   color:#ffffff;
   font-size:27px;
}
.texto {
   font-family: Trebuchet MS, Arial;
   color:#000000;
   font-size:12px;
}

h5{
	color:#f58b00;
	font-family: Trebuchet MS, Arial;
	font-size:18px;
}

h4{
	color:#cc3300;
   	font-family: Trebuchet MS, Arial;
	font-size:20px;
}

/************************************************** Internas Final **********************************************************/

/***********************/
/***    PARCEIROS    ***/
/***********************/

.parceiros{
	list-style:none;
	padding: 0 0 0.5em 0;
	margin: 0 0.8em 0 0.8em;
	float:left;
}
.parceiros2{
	padding: 0 0 0.5em 0;
	margin: 0 0.8em 0 13em;
}
.parceiros6{
	list-style:none;
	padding: 0 0 0 0;
	margin: 0 0 0 0;
	float:left;
}

.middle-column-img-left2{
	float:inherit;
	margin: 0.3em 0em 0em 0.5em;
	border: none;	
}

.semborda{
	border:none;
}